7 Hidden Signs in the Body
- Chronic Muscle Tension: Especially in the jaw, neck, shoulders, and psoas (hip flexors), which brace the body for impact.
- Digestive Issues: The gut is highly sensitive to nervous system dysregulation (IBS, chronic bloating).
- Hypervigilance: An exaggerated startle response to loud noises or unexpected touch.
- Chronic Fatigue: Being stuck in a "freeze" state drains massive amounts of cellular energy.
- Disconnecting from the Body: Feeling numb, ungrounded, or like you are floating outside of yourself (dissociation).
